Skepta, one of the UK's most prominent grime musicians and producers, can add a new title to his resume: artist and curator.
The curated auction features works from both emerging and established artists including a painting made by Skepta's himself.The British-Nigerian describes the work, called"Mama Goes to Market," as a"brought-together memory of Nigeria," in a press release. It is his first painting and was created during a Covid-19 lockdown in 2020.
Although art is a new venture for the musician, he said that it was a natural transition."When you make music -- because it comes with music videos, styling, set design and everything else -- you naturally get subsumed into the world of art as well, getting your teeth stuck into different movements styles as a way to inspire your own creativity," Skepta told CNN over email.The show is the second London edition of Sotheby's Contemporary Curated series held this year..
The graffiti etched onto the walls of Skepta's painting were additions made by artist Slawn, music producer and graffiti artist Goldie and graphic designer Chito. Pieces by each artist will feature in Skepta's guest edit which makes up 10 of the total 88 pieces up for auction.
